John Logan To Write Next Two James Bond Films

Post by Goldeneye »

http://www.deadline.com/2012/10/gladiat ... ond-films/
the franchise’s producers have quietly made a deal with John Logan to write not one but two 007 films. I’m told that Logan pitched an original two-movie arc to Barbara Broccoli and Michael Wilson while they were shooting Skyfall, and that he has already begun writing the scripts. If plans work out, this would be the first Bond film with a storyline to be played out over multiple films, and it certainly makes it feasible that the pictures could be shot back-to-back. October 25th the Bond producers are not ready to move on Bond 24. October 27th they hired a new writer months ago?

http://www.denofgeek.com/movies/skyfall ... ng-skyfall

Have any preparations been made for Bond 24 yet?

Broccoli: No, no.

How long a space do you think you’ll need?

Wilson: If we’re rapid it’ll be two years, if we’re not it’ll be three. It’ll be in that time period.

Have you engaged [writers Neal Purvis and Robert Wade] yet?

Broccoli: We haven’t done too much about doing deals over the next film, because we’ve literally just finished this film last week. It’s that close. So I think we just want to open this one, have a bit of a break and get on with the next one.

To update this thread, the denials were still in effect until mid-November. That's when Gary Barber, the CEO of MGM, said Logan had, indeed, been hired to write the next two Bond films. Logan, subsequently, has acknowledged this.
